District Track Results
by Ted Peck
May 18, 2009
The Stanton track teams competed at the C-5 district track meet
held in Hartington on Thursday, May 14. Individual state qualifiers
include: Pat Campbell in the long jump, Lexi Sieh in the high jump,
and Sam Unger in the triple jump and 300 meter low hurdles. Also
qualifying for state competition was the 400 meter relay team of
Pat Campbell, Josh Herscheid, Chase Quinn, and Tate Erbst. A school
record was set by Pat Campbell in the long jump. His leap of 22’ 4
inches bettered the old mark of 21’ 8 _ which had stood since 1990.
State competition begins Friday, May 22 at Burke Stadium in
Omaha.
